La présente invention concerne un dispositif permettant d'afficher un point d'un symbole alphanumérique de n'importe quelle structure matricielle par le déplacement d'une sphère dans une tube par effet gravimétrique.The present invention relates to a device making it possible to display a point of an alphanumeric symbol of any matrix structure by the displacement of a sphere in a tube by gravimetric effect.
Les afficheurs électromécaniques matriciels récents habituellement dans la configuration 7 lois 5 points fonctionnent selon le principe éléotromgnétique avec des aimants permanents qui sont solidaires avec des éléments d'affichage ayant un ou. deux axes de libertés. Bans un champ magnétique d'exitation ces éléments font un déplacement linéaire ou rotorique ce qui a pour effet l'apparition ou la disparition d'un point d une couleur opposée à celle du fond.Recent matrix electromechanical displays, usually in the 7-law, 5-point configuration, operate on the electro-magnetic principle with permanent magnets which are integral with display elements having one or. two axes of freedom. In an excitation magnetic field these elements make a linear or rotoric displacement which has the effect of the appearance or disappearance of a point of a color opposite to that of the background.
Ce dispositif d'invention est constitué d un tube (1) a' l'intérieur duquel se déplace librement une sphère (2). Le tube bascule sur un axe (3) transversal et horizontal par un effet quelconque.This inventive device consists of a tube (1) inside which a sphere (2) moves freely. The tube rocks on a transverse and horizontal axis (3) by any effect.
A l'une des extrémités du tube (I) est fixé un limitateur de déplacement (4) de la sphère (2) et l'autre extrémité du tube est montée sur l'axe (3) Le support (5i de l'axe ainsi que le dispositif de bascule (6) sont fixes solidairement sur une plaque (7) Le levier (8) pivotant du dispositif de bascule (6) es solidaire du tuile (1) et le fait basculer dans deux positions stables, de l'angle positif (+ss) à l'angle négatif (-ss) et inversement par rapport à l'horizontale (X) La sphère (2) se déplace toujours dans sa position stable.At one end of the tube (I) is fixed a displacement limiter (4) of the sphere (2) and the other end of the tube is mounted on the axis (3) The support (5i of the axis as well as the rocking device (6) are fixed integrally on a plate (7) The lever (8) pivoting of the rocking device (6) is integral with the tile (1) and makes it tilt in two stable positions, from the positive angle (+ ss) to the negative angle (-ss) and vice versa with respect to the horizontal (X) The sphere (2) always moves in its stable position.
La Fig. 1 présente la position avec l'angle négatif (-ss) qu a provoquée le de placement de la sphère - (2) vers l'extérieur du tube (1) et qui a constitue un point d'affiobage. Fig. 1 shows the position with the negative angle (-ss) that caused the placement of the sphere - (2) towards the outside of the tube (1) and which has constituted a point of affiobage.
La Fig. 2 présente la position inverse qui a provoque la descente de la sphère (2) vers le fond du tube (i).Fig. 2 shows the opposite position which caused the descent of the sphere (2) towards the bottom of the tube (i).
Il est préférable de réaliser le dispositif de bascule (6) avec un élément électromagnétique bistable.It is preferable to make the tilting device (6) with a bistable electromagnetic element.
La couleur du tube et du fond de l'afficheur est opposée à celle de la sphère.The color of the tube and the background of the display is opposite to that of the sphere.
La longeur du tube est suffisante pour que la sphère en position intérieure évite les rayons directs des sources lumineuses extérieures.The length of the tube is sufficient for the sphere in the internal position to avoid direct rays from external light sources.
La réalisation du tube (1) et de la sphère (2) est de préférence en matériaux légers.The realization of the tube (1) and the sphere (2) is preferably made of light materials.
Ce type d'affichage avec les apparitions des sphères a un angle de visibilité très grand la taille de la réalisation de ce dispositif n' est pas limitée.This type of display with the appearances of the spheres has a very large visibility angle. The size of the embodiment of this device is not limited.
Ce dispositif est destiné à réaliser l'affichage alphanumérique dans les lieux publics. This device is intended to produce alphanumeric display in public places.
